Exemplo n.º 1
0
        public IActionResult RequestToken(TokenRequest request)
        {
            TokenOutput output = new TokenOutput();

            if (!ModelState.IsValid)
            {
                output.status           = false;
                output.ValidationErrors = ModelState.FetchErrors();
                return(BadRequest(ModelState));
            }

            string token = _authService.IsAuthenticated(request);

            if (!string.IsNullOrEmpty(token))
            {
                output.status = true;
                output.result = token;
            }
            else
            {
                output.result = "invalid username and/or password";
                output.status = false;
            }

            return(Ok(output));
        }
 public void Add(List <string> msg)
 {
     foreach (string tmp in msg)
     {
         TokenOutput.Document.Blocks.Add(new Paragraph(new Run(tmp.Replace("(bootloader) ", ""))));
     }
     TokenOutput.ScrollToEnd();
 }